DYCSoccer17 (2040), Davis, California, USA Jul 6, 2008 11.2 ounce bottle purchased at Burgers ’N Brew in Davis, CA. I cannot say I have ever seen this beer for sale before. Aroma has plenty of cherries with some vinous wine-like properties present. A bit spicy with some Fruit Roll-Up-like aromas. Smells goooood. Transparent garnet-ruby body with a small, light puce head. Scant lacing present. Starts a bit tart and astringent with enough sweet cherry flavors to back it up. A little spicy in the middle with some vinous wine-grapey flavors. A bit of a dry finish. Tasty.

WisconsinBeer (346), St Paul, Minnesota, USA Oct 4, 2008 On tap, Muddy Pig. Pours a deep ruby red color with minimal head. Flavor is initially dry and tart, a bit fizzy, but rolls into a mellow lingering cherry sweetness. Flavors of oak, vanilla, and port wine also present. Medium bodied, somewhat syrupy. Well done for a fruit beer. Illini08 (519), Raleigh, North Carolina, USA Oct 4, 2008 Sampled at the Sep. Carolina Crew gathering. Light red or mahogany color. Cough syrup aroma.
